Data storage method and disk array

A disk array and data storage technology, applied in the field of communication, can solve problems such as array failure, surveillance video cannot be stored continuously, user loss, etc., to achieve accurate storage and avoid the effect of disk array failure

Active Publication Date: 2017-03-22
ZHEJIANG UNIVIEW TECH CO LTD
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0008] For such fake and short-lived large number of disk media errors at the bottom layer, the RAID software will deal with them according to the array level, but there will be a high probability that the command will fail to return, causing the array to become a failure state
In the monitoring environment, the monitoring video will not be able to continue to be stored, and the monitoring video will be lost, which will bring serious losses to the user.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data storage method and disk array
  • Data storage method and disk array
  • Data storage method and disk array

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0045] As mentioned in the background art, in the existing disk array, due to comprehensive factors such as SAS controllers and disk links, a large number of disks may have problems in a short period of time, but this is not a media problem of the disks themselves. After a period of time, when the SAS controller and the disk link return to normal, the false problem of the disk will also be restored. In the prior art, such a transient and false failure of the disk is considered as a problem with the disk itself, and the disk array is degraded or rebuilt. In the application of the monitoring environment, after the array fails, the monitoring video will not be able to continue to be stored, and the monitoring video will also be lost, which will bring serious losses to the user.

[0046]Therefore, in order to avoid the failure of the disk array caused by a large number of short-term pseudo-medium errors of the disk, and to ensure that the surveillance video can be stored completel...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a data storage method. The method comprises the steps that when write failure information returned by disks for cache data is received, a disk controller judges whether the time during which faults occurs in the disks is smaller than a preset first time threshold or not; if the time is smaller than the preset first time threshold, the disk controller keeps a state of a disk array unchanged and returns failure information to array caches, wherein the failure information is used for enabling the array caches to continuously store the cache data and resend the cache data to the disk controller according to a preset cache refreshing policy. During a disk fault time period, the disk controller repeatedly sends the failure information to the array caches, so the cache data can be repeatedly written into the disks, and after the disks are returned to normal, the cache data can be successfully stored in the disks. The disk array failure resulting from a large number of transient disk false medium errors is avoided, and monitoring video data is guaranteed to be stored continuously, completely and accurately.

Description

technical field [0001] The present invention relates to the field of communication technology, in particular to a data storage method, and in particular to a disk array. Background technique [0002] In the prior art, a storage server can manage a large number of disks through a SAS (Serial Attached SCSI, serial SCSI technology) controller. For example, in addition to a group of disks managed by the storage server itself, multi-level disk cabinets can be cascaded through SAS cables to manage all these disks, and are used to create arrays and provide services to the outside world. [0003] In actual application, it is found that since the stability and reliability of the underlying processing of the SAS controller and disk are uncontrollable, once a problem occurs, it will have a great impact on the upper storage software. In particular, in the application of the monitoring environment, due to comprehensive factors such as SAS controllers and disk links, a large number of di...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06
CPCG06F3/0619G06F3/0622G06F3/0656G06F3/0689
Inventor 王丽红郭永强许勇
Owner ZHEJIANG UNIVIEW T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products